In Vivo Model of Small Intestine.


ABSTRACT: The utilization of human pluripotent stem cells (hPSCs) offers new avenues in the generation of organs and opportunities to understand development and diseases. The hPSC-derived human intestinal organoids (HIOs) provide a new tool to gain insights in small intestinal development, physiology, and associated diseases. Herein, we provide a method for orthotropic transplantation of HIOs in immunocompromised mice. This method highlights the specific steps to successful engraftment and provides insight into the study of bioengineered human small intestine.
